 SPORTS-An endeavour that requires both mental and physical effort, and is carried out in accordance with certain guidelines.  SPORTS AUTHORITY OF INDIA (SAI)- is the supreme governing organisation for sports in India. It was created in 1984 by the Ministry of Youth Affairs and Sports of the

Government of India with the purpose of fostering the growth of sports in the country.  MINISTRY OF YOUTH AFFAIRS AND SPORTS- a department under the government of India that is responsible for managing both the Department of Youth

Affairs and the Department of Sports in that country.  KHELO INDIA- Khelo India aspires to improve India's sports culture at the grassroots level via talent discovery, organised contests, and infrastructure development. Prime

Minister Narendra Modi, Sports Ministers Vijay Goel and Rajyavardhan Singh Rathore inaugurated the initiative in 2017-18.  SPORTS COMPLEX- is a collection of different athletic venues. Stadiums for track and field, football, and baseball, as well as swimming pools and gymnasiums, are all examples of facilities that fall under the category of "sportszone."  ARENA- the enclosing of a space for the purpose of exhibiting sports and other spectacles to an audience.  ATHLETIC CENTRE-is a collection of different athletic venues.  LEISURE- liberation from the obligations of one's employment or duties.  STADIUM- A big building used for sporting events that is often open on all sides and has tiered seating for spectators.
